کار با سرور مجازی (VPS) اوبونتو لینوکس

ادریس رنجبر

آبان 12, 1398

سلام دوستان و دنبال کنندگان عزیز وب سایت و آموزش ها. یه سری آموزشی رایگان دیگه شروع کردیم تحت عنوان کار با سرور مجازی. می خوایم کار کردن با یه سرور مجازی یاVirtual Private Server (VPS) لینوکسی رو یاد بگیریم. نه حرفه ای اما در حدی که کارامون رو بتونیم راه بندازیم. مثلا وب سرور رو کانفیگ کنیم؛ یه سری پکیج حذف و نصب کنیم؛ سایت وردپرسی خودمون رو بالا بیاریم و… این قست PHP و وب سرور Apache2 و همچین MySQL رو نصب می کنیم. توصیه ام به شما اینه که حتما از Tmux استفاده کنید و شل پیشنهادی من هم ZSH هستش.

قسمت اول

تو این قسمت دستورات زیر رو استفاده کردیم:

ssh yourUserName@yourVPSIP
sudo adduser yourUserName
sudo usermod -aG sudo yourUserName
sudo apt install tmux
sudo apt install zsh
sudo apt install mysql-server
sudo apt install php
sudo apt install appach2

اگه نمی دونید VPS چیه: VPS مخفف Virtual Private Server هستش یعنی سرور مجازی خصوصی. در واقع ارزون تر از سرور واقعیه. سرور های واقعی رو میان چند قسمت می کنن (از لحاظ منابع سخت افزاری مثل CPU, Ram , Hard disk) و با قیمت ارزون تر می فروشن. وی پی اس ها قابلیت های خیلی بیشتری از هاست های اشتراکی دارن؛ نمونش همین ssh گرفتن و دسترسی از راه دوره. حالا وی پی اس ها می تونن تعرفه های مختلف و سیستم عامل های متفاوت داشته باشن.



قسمت دوم

در این قسمت (قسمت دوم) از سری آموزشی کار با سرور مجازی یا همون وی پی اس لینوکس؛ به کانفیگ وب سرور Apache2 می پردازیم.

در واقع این قسمت کاری می کنم کارستون 🙂 . میایم و یه پوشه به اسم public_html توی پوشه ی Home یوزر خودمون می سازیم. و وب سرور رو طوری کانفیگ می کنیم که از اونجا محتویات رو بخونه و وقتی ای پی یا ادرس سایت رو زدن بره و سایت رو نمایش بده.

تو این قسمت دستورات زیر رو استفاده کردیم:

cd home/tourUserName
mkdir public_html
vim index.php
cd /etc/apache2/sites-available
cp 000-default.conf edris.conf
a2dissite 000-default.conf
a2ensite edris.conf
systemctl restart apache2

قسمت سوم

سلام و عرض ادب خدمت شما دنبال کنندگان محترم آموزش های کار با سرور مجازی لینوکس. در این قسمت (قسمت سوم) از سری آموزشی کار با سرور مجازی یا همون وی پی اس لینوکس؛ به خرید یه دامنه رایگان از وب سایت freenom.com می پردازیم. با استفاده از این وب سایت یک دامنه ی رایگان با پسوند .tk تهیه کردیم که به مدت یک سال در دسترس خواهد بود) و آن را با استفاده از DNS به ای پی ادرس سرور مجازی خود متصل کردیم. از این طریق ما قادر خواهیم بود به جای ای پی ادرس از دامنه ی خود استفاده کنیم.


قسمت چهارم

در این قسمت (قسمت چهارم) از سری آموزشی کار با سرور مجازی یا همون وی پی اس لینوکس؛ کاری می کنیم که از این به بعد بشه تو ترمینال با زدن مثلا ssh edris@edris به سرور وصل بشیم. یعنی نیازی به وارد کردن ای پی سرور نباشه.


قسمت پنجم

در این قسمت (قسمت پنجم) از سری آموزشی کار با سرور مجازی یا همون وی پی اس لینوکس؛ سیستم مدیریت محتوای وردپرس رو که محبوبترین CMS دنیاست؛ نصب می کنیم. برای این کار ابتدا فایل فشرده آخرین نسخه ی وردپرس را از سایت رسمی آن دانلود و استخراج (Extract) می کنیم. سپس وارد مراحل نصب می شویم؛ یک کاربر و بعد از ان یک دیتابیس هم در MySql می سازیم.


این سری آموزش ها باز هم ادامه داره و سعی می کنم زود به زود آپدیت کنم. حتما از طریق منوی سایت پیگیر اپدیت این دسته بندی باشید که قسمت های جدید این سری رو از دست ندین. راستی اگه خواستید میتونید از آموزش ها هم حمایت کنید.

جهت استفاده از سایر آموزش ها حتما از آموزش های دیگه دیدن کنید و همچنین صفحه ی آپارات من رو دنبال کنید.

0


د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*